An air bubble doubles its radius on raising from the bottom of water reservoir to the surface of water in it. If the atmosphetic pressure is equal to 10 m of water, the height of water in the reservoir will be
A. 10 m
B. 20 m
C. 70 m
D. 80 m

Correct Answer - C
`r_(2)=2r_(1)`
`(V_(2))/(V_(1))=((r_(2))/(r_(1)))^(3)=((2r)/(r))^(3)=8`
`V_(2)=8V_(1) `
`P_(1)V_(1)=P_(2)V_(2)`
`(P_(0)+h rho g)V_(1)=P_(2)xx8V_(1)`
`h rho g=80rhog-10rhog`
`therefore h=80-10` ltrgt `=70m.`
